About the Covenants
Hebrews 9:8 the Holy Spirit indicating this, that the way into the Holiest of All was not yet made manifest while the first tabernacle (A shadow of our corruptible body) was still standing.
11 But Christ came as High Priest of the good things to come, with the greater and more perfect tabernacle not made with hands (The inner man, 1 Cor.12:27), that is, not of this creation.
15 And for this reason He is the Mediator of the new covenant, by means of death, for the redemption of the transgressions under the first covenant (Forgiveness of our sins), that those who are called may receive the promise of the eternal inheritance.
Hebrews 10:9 then He said, “Behold, I have come to do Your will, O God.” He takes away the first that He may establish the second.
We are not under the Law of Moses, not even the Ten Commandments! We are under the Spiritual New Covenant Laws of Jesus Christ as He explains in the Sermon on the Mount. Matthew 5:21 “You have heard that it was said to those of old, ‘You shall not murder, and whoever murders will be in danger of the judgment.’
22 But I say to you that whoever is angry with his brother without a cause shall be in danger of the judgment.
Matthew5: 27 “You have heard that it was said to those of old, ‘You shall not commit adultery.’
28 But I say to you that whoever looks at a woman to lust for her has already committed adultery with her in his heart.
Under the Old Law you literally had to commit the offense to be guilty, but under the New Covenant Laws of Christ if you harbor the offense in the heart you are guilty.
10 By that will we have been sanctified through the offering of the body of Jesus Christ once for all.
15 But the Holy Spirit also witnesses to us; for after He had said before,
16 “This is the covenant that I will make with them after those days, says the LORD: I will put My laws into their hearts, and in their minds I will write them,”
The Spiritual laws of Jesus Christ as referenced in the Sermon on the Mount.
17 then He adds, “Their sins and their lawless deeds I will remember no more.”
Jesus shed His blood for the remission of all sins, past, present, and future. Jesus took all sins to the grave and buried them there forever.
18 Now where there is remission of these, there is no longer an offering for sin.
This is where the covenants changed from the Levitical priesthood of the tribe of Levi to the Judean priesthood of the tribe of Judah with Christ as the High Priest.
Hebrews 7:11 Therefore, if perfection were through the Levitical priesthood (for under it the people received the law), what further need was there that another priest should rise according to the order of Melchizedek, and not be called according to the order of Aaron?
12 For the priesthood being changed, of necessity there is also a change of the law.
13 For He of whom these things are spoken belongs to another tribe, from which no man has officiated at the altar.
14 For it is evident that our Lord arose from Judah, of which tribe Moses spoke nothing concerning priesthood.
15 And it is yet far more evident if, in the likeness of Melchizedek, there arises another priest
16 who has come, not according to the law of a fleshly commandment, but according to the power of an endless life.
17 For He testifies: ” You are a priest forever According to the order of Melchizedek.”
